web前端主要做什么工作内容的

fiy 其他 73

回复

共3条回复 我来回复
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    Web前端主要负责网站或应用程序的前端开发,具体工作内容包括以下几个方面:

    一、页面布局和设计
    Web前端开发人员负责根据设计师提供的设计稿或UI界面原型,将其转化为网页或应用程序的页面布局。这包括选择合适的颜色、字体、图片等元素,并使用HTML、CSS等技术进行排版和布局,使得页面风格美观、布局合理。

    二、前端编码
    Web前端开发人员还需要使用HTML、CSS、JavaScript等前端技术进行编码。他们需要将页面中的各个元素以及与用户的交互行为编写成相应的前端代码,实现页面的动态效果和交互功能。例如,通过JavaScript实现表单验证、页面动画、异步加载等功能。

    三、浏览器兼容性处理
    由于不同的浏览器对网页的渲染引擎和标准支持程度不同,Web前端开发人员需要进行浏览器兼容性处理,确保网页在不同浏览器上的正确显示和正常运行。他们需要针对不同浏览器的特性进行适配和调试,使得页面在不同浏览器下的用户体验一致。

    四、性能优化
    Web前端开发人员还需要优化网页的加载速度和性能。他们可以通过压缩和合并CSS和JavaScript代码、使用图片精灵等技术来减少网页的加载时间;使用缓存机制和懒加载等技术来提高用户的访问速度和体验。

    五、移动端适配
    随着移动设备的普及,Web前端开发人员还需要进行移动端适配。他们需要使用响应式设计或者针对不同的设备尺寸和屏幕分辨率进行适配,使得网页在不同大小的移动设备上都能正常显示和使用。

    六、与后端开发人员的协作
    Web前端开发人员还需要与后端开发人员协作,配合完成网站或应用程序的功能实现。他们通常会与后端开发人员进行接口对接,使用Ajax等技术进行数据交互,实现前后端的数据传输和交互。

    总结起来,Web前端主要负责网站或应用程序的页面布局、前端编码、浏览器兼容性处理、性能优化、移动端适配等工作内容,并与后端开发人员密切配合,共同实现网站或应用程序的功能需求。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    Web前端主要负责网页的开发和设计,包括用户界面的构建、交互功能的实现以及与后端进行数据交互等工作。具体而言,Web前端的工作内容主要包括以下几个方面:

    1. 网页布局与样式设计:Web前端需要负责将网页设计师提供的设计稿转化为网页的布局和样式。他们使用HTML和CSS语言来定义网页的结构和外观,确保页面在不同的浏览器和设备上都能显示出相同的效果。

    2. 用户交互功能的实现:Web前端负责实现用户在网页上的各种交互功能,包括表单提交、按钮点击、下拉选择等。他们使用JavaScript语言来编写客户端脚本,以实现页面中的交互效果,并与后端进行数据交互。

    3. 响应式设计与移动端适配:随着移动设备的普及,Web前端需要确保网页能够在不同尺寸的屏幕上适应,并提供良好的用户体验。他们使用响应式设计技术来实现网页的自适应,使其能够在桌面、平板和手机等不同设备上展示出最佳效果。

    4. 浏览器兼容性测试与修复:Web前端需要进行浏览器兼容性测试,以确保网页在不同浏览器和版本上都能正确显示和运行。他们会检查和修复可能出现的兼容性问题,以提升用户体验。

    5. 性能优化与代码优化:Web前端需要优化网页的性能,以提高页面的加载速度和响应时间。他们会对网页进行压缩、合并资源文件、使用缓存等技术手段,减少网络请求和提升加载速度。同时还需要对代码进行合理组织和优化,提高代码的可维护性和可重用性。

    总之,Web前端主要负责网页的开发和设计工作,涵盖网页布局样式设计、用户交互功能实现、响应式设计、浏览器兼容性测试与修复、性能优化与代码优化等多个方面。通过前端的工作,能够提供给用户一个美观、高效、易用的网页体验。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    Web前端主要负责开发和设计网页的用户界面部分,其主要工作内容包括以下几个方面:

    1. 网页页面布局设计:使用HTML(超文本标记语言)和CSS(层叠样式表)等技术,将网页的布局设计成用户友好的界面。通过合理的排版、色彩搭配和图像处理等,使网页具有良好的视觉效果和用户体验。

    2. 前端交互逻辑开发:使用JavaScript等脚本技术,实现网页上的交互功能,例如表单验证、动态内容加载、用户操作反馈等。通过编写适当的脚本代码,使网页具有更丰富的功能和交互性。

    3. 网页性能优化:通过优化前端代码、压缩资源文件、减少HTTP请求等手段,提高网页的加载速度和性能。优化网页的渲染过程、减少页面闪烁等问题,使用户能够更快地访问和使用网页。

    4. 多平台适配与响应式设计:考虑不同设备的屏幕分辨率和尺寸,使网页在不同的设备上能够自适应地展示并具有良好的观感和使用体验。采用响应式设计的思路,使网页能够在桌面、平板和手机等不同设备上显示适配的布局和内容。

    5. 浏览器兼容性处理:针对不同的浏览器,处理和解决兼容性问题。考虑不同浏览器对HTML、CSS和JavaScript的解析和支持程度,通过针对性的代码写法和兼容性处理技巧,使网页在各大主流浏览器上都能够正常显示和运行。

    6. 前端框架和工具使用:使用各种前端框架和工具,例如jQuery、React、Vue.js等,加快网页开发的速度和提高开发效率。通过了解和掌握这些框架和工具的使用方法,能够更好地完成前端开发任务。

    7. 与后端开发的协作:与后端开发人员合作,完成网页与服务器之间的数据交互和接口对接。前端负责处理用户界面和前端逻辑,将用户的操作传递给后端进行处理,并将后端返回的数据展示给用户。

    总之,Web前端的工作内容是与用户界面和用户体验相关的,主要包括网页布局设计、前端交互逻辑开发、网页性能优化、多平台适配与响应式设计、浏览器兼容性处理、前端框架和工具使用以及与后端开发的协作等方面。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部